Output 2423b9460b4fcb6b05c71def1c1ccf9f0f82a876955280379cb5a2fc64acf993:0

value
99914913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0768f38a3e9d82d64122757e2e0070e1ae2fc728 OP_EQUAL
address
32NCP2rDoNATHPgdujU1TfSFpenZC7SUQw
transaction
2423b9460b4fcb6b05c71def1c1ccf9f0f82a876955280379cb5a2fc64acf993
spent
true